The skills, knowledge and experience you need:

  • Proven software engineering expertise in design, development, and support of complex systems.
  • Leadership experience managing multiple engineering teams, setting standards, and driving consistency.
  • Strong knowledge of microservices, event-driven architectures, and modern engineering practices.
  • Ability to define priorities, delegate effectively, and coach teams to build capability.
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ills, including explaining technical concepts to non-technical audiences.
  • Familiarity with technical governance, domain-driven design, and continuous improvement in engineering practices.

You and your role


As a Lead Software Engineer, you'll set engineering standards, promote best practices, and enable teams to deliver high-quality software.

You'll use your leadership and collaboration skills to influence the department's technical vision, resolve blockers, and foster collaboration across the engineering community.

This role is about leading multiple engineering teams within DWP Digital, making sure the right people are working on the right problems, and shaping how we build future technology solutions that deliver real value to millions of users. You'll work across citizen-facing products, contact centre solutions, and platform services, driving innovation and problem-solving at scale.

You'll also play a key role in advancing engineering practices across DWP and government, accelerating the adoption of microservices and event-driven architectures, and supporting the next generation of engineers through coaching and recruitment.

This is a senior leadership position where you'll be able to be strategic and hands-on, and help us shape services that really work for people all across the UK.

Proud member of the Disability Confident employer scheme

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
